Slow Cooker (or not) Hawaiian Pulled Pork Sliders | Cook Smarts
Experience the flavors of Hawaii with our Slow Cooker (or not) Hawaiian Pulled Pork Sliders, perfect for reducing dinner decisions and enjoying tasty sliders with tangy slaw.
Ingredients
- 1 lb Snap peas, fresh or frozen
- 1 Tbsp Oil, cooking
- 1 tsp Chili garlic sauce (sub any hot sauce)
- 1 tsp Sesame seeds, white (opt)
- 1/4 cup Hoisin sauce
- 2 Tbsp + 2 Tbsp Soy sauce, low-sodium
- 2 tsp Lime juice
- 1 tsp Oil, toasted sesame
- 2 1/2 lbs Pork, boneless shoulder roast (sometimes labeled pork butt)
- 1/2 cup Stock, any type
- 2 stalks Green onions, chopped, green and white parts combined
- 10 oz Coleslaw mix
- 2 tsp Vinegar, rice
- 1 tsp Brown sugar
- 1 tsp Fish sauce
- 12 Slider buns / rolls, small (look for sweet Hawaiian slider rolls; sub 1 regular hamburger bun per serving)
- ~3 cups Hawaiian Pulled Pork (ingredients listed separately)
